본문 바로가기
  • 지요미의 IT성장일기
728x90

분류 전체보기181

트랜잭션(Transaction) - 병행 제어, 로킹, 타임스탬프출처 트랜잭션이란? Transaction데이터베이스의 상태를 변화시키기 해서 수행하는 작업의 단위 원자성 (Atomicity) :트랜잭션이 데이터베이스에 모두 반영되던가, 아니면 전혀 반영되지 않아야 한다는 것일관성 (Consistency) : 트랜잭션의 작업 처리 결과가 항상 일관성이 있어야 한다는 것독립성 (Isolation) : 둘 이상의 트랜잭션이 동시에 실행되었을 때, 어떤 하나의 트랜잭션이라도 다른 트랜잭션의 연산에 끼어들 수 없는 것지속성 (Durability) : 트랜잭션이 성공적으로 완료되었을 경우, 결과는 영구적으로 반영되어야 한다는 것  병행제어란? Concurrency Control"병행"은 매우 빠르게 여러 트랜잭션 사이를 이동하면서 조금씩 처리를 수행하는 방식.실제로는 한번에 한번의 .. 2025. 1. 31.
GTM GTM ; Google Tag Manager 구글 태그 매니저(GTM)는 구글 마케팅 플랫폼에서 제공하는 무료 서비스.코드를 수정하지 않고도 웹사이트에 심어진 태그를 관리하는 툴이며 다양한 마케팅을 뒷받침하는 강력한 도구.GTM 설치하기 1. 설치한 사이트에 GTM을 설치https://tagmanager.google.com/#/home Google 애널리틱스로그인 Google 애널리틱스로 이동accounts.google.com 2. 계정 정보 입력 - 컨테이너 설정컨테이너는 하나의 작업 환경. 하나의 계정에 여러 개의 컨테이너를 만들 수 있고, 작업자 또는 웹/앱 환경 별로 여러 개의 컨테이너 생성 가능. (타겟 플랫폼은 웹사이트에 설치되기 때문에 '웹'으로 설정)  3. 홈페이지 사이트에 GTM 스크립.. 2025. 1. 3.
AKS 생성 + AGW 연결까지 AKS 만들기 어차피 cli로 노드풀은 새로 생성할 예정이기 때문에.. System 모드만 생성해 주었다.(AKS 생성시, 노드 풀에 각각의 서브넷을 배정해주려면 포털에서는 불가능..) 네트워크 선택~~ 나머지는 기존 구축된 AKS 참고했다.여하튼.. AKS 만들기~~    공용 IP 주소 만들기Application gateway를 만들기 전에, 공용IP주소를 먼저 만들어 주어야 한다. Application Gateway는 클라이언트 요청을 처리하기 위해 프론트엔드 IP 구성이 필요하다.- Pub IP: 외부에서 접근할 수 있는 경우.- Pvt IP: VNet 내에서만 접근할 수 있는 경우.Pub IP 사용시, Application Gateway는 이 Pub IP를 통해 외부 요청을 수신하므로공용 IP .. 2024. 12. 6.
kubectl command / pod 생성하기 보호되어 있는 글 입니다. 2024. 10. 30.
helm study 보호되어 있는 글 입니다. 2024. 10. 29.
728x90